Well, seeing as how none of these models existed last week, or even were started...the goal right now is to see if there any interest in these as miniatures. Right now that's unknown, and I would say this project is pretty much my own fleet to game with, or for those who ask for copies. There is some enthusiasm, but its unknown if that would translate into actual sales. The 3D printed models are currently at shapeways cost for zero profit, as I can't get them printed at a price thats reasonable unless I get my own printer. It's currently a catch 22 as the costs for me to manufacture these are considerable, so I'd need to see real interest before that would happen. It would also take some time to rebuild the models to be turned into multipart kits.
Further research will also show that the Hornet is by Colin Hay. The original painting was used for an Isaac Asimov novel, and I suspect the TTA book was a secondary showcase to see the paintings without all the book titles and text. Mr Hay has been selling off the originals. I'd love to sell enough minis to buy an original painting from him, or even a print from Foss.
That said, I do have the full capability and partners to create rules that would use these miniatures and incorporate the lore of the TTA universe. That would be a fully licensed project. We could incorporate these into the rulesets I'm currentlyexploring for the other miniatures I'm doing, by creating a supplement or even a standalone game.
I'm literally a week into this though. Last week I was debating more original designs for miniatures and ended up creating these to just kill some time. For now it's about getting people interested for anything to be able to happen.

The license issue is definitely something to consider, although I doubt Foss (or Hay) comes into it directly. Someone (apparently Cowley, the author) owns the rights to the TTA as an IP, and that someone licensed an RPG (unreleased AFAIK) and a modernized printing of the books not all that long ago, through Morrigan Press at first and later a failed KS from Battlefield Press. They're the people you need to talk to. The wiki page for the Terran Trade Authority has all this info, but you'll have to dig deeper and get some legal eagles to do proper research. Morrigan ran into problems with an erroneous licensor originally themselves, don't want to have that happen again.
Oh, and I've said it before - the ACM 113 Fat Boy gets my Most Wanted Mini vote, followed immediately afterward by the Proximan Toad.
If you want a rules system for the figs, I'd strongly advise talking to Jon Tuffley about a Full Thrust mod, and if he's not game, to Dan Kast about Starmada.
